Chromium Code Reviews
chromiumcodereview-hr@appspot.gserviceaccount.com (chromiumcodereview-hr) | Please choose your nickname with Settings | Help | Chromium Project | Gerrit Changes | Sign out
(178)

Side by Side Diff: chrome/chrome_browser.gypi

Issue 6869024: Add IME UI related extension API. (Closed) Base URL: http://git.chromium.org/git/chromium.git@trunk
Patch Set: Rebase Created 9 years, 7 months ago
Use n/p to move between diff chunks; N/P to move between comments. Draft comments are only viewable by you.
Jump to:
View unified diff | Download patch | Annotate | Revision Log
OLDNEW
1 # Copyright (c) 2011 The Chromium Authors. All rights reserved. 1 # Copyright (c) 2011 The Chromium Authors. All rights reserved.
2 # Use of this source code is governed by a BSD-style license that can be 2 # Use of this source code is governed by a BSD-style license that can be
3 # found in the LICENSE file. 3 # found in the LICENSE file.
4 4
5 { 5 {
6 'targets': [ 6 'targets': [
7 { 7 {
8 'target_name': 'browser', 8 'target_name': 'browser',
9 'type': '<(library)', 9 'type': '<(library)',
10 'msvs_guid': '5BF908A7-68FB-4A4B-99E3-8C749F1FE4EA', 10 'msvs_guid': '5BF908A7-68FB-4A4B-99E3-8C749F1FE4EA',
(...skipping 899 matching lines...) Expand 10 before | Expand all | Expand 10 after
910 'browser/extensions/extension_info_private_api_chromeos.cc', 910 'browser/extensions/extension_info_private_api_chromeos.cc',
911 'browser/extensions/extension_info_private_api_chromeos.h', 911 'browser/extensions/extension_info_private_api_chromeos.h',
912 'browser/extensions/extension_infobar_delegate.cc', 912 'browser/extensions/extension_infobar_delegate.cc',
913 'browser/extensions/extension_infobar_delegate.h', 913 'browser/extensions/extension_infobar_delegate.h',
914 'browser/extensions/extension_infobar_module.cc', 914 'browser/extensions/extension_infobar_module.cc',
915 'browser/extensions/extension_infobar_module.h', 915 'browser/extensions/extension_infobar_module.h',
916 'browser/extensions/extension_infobar_module_constants.cc', 916 'browser/extensions/extension_infobar_module_constants.cc',
917 'browser/extensions/extension_infobar_module_constants.h', 917 'browser/extensions/extension_infobar_module_constants.h',
918 'browser/extensions/extension_input_api.cc', 918 'browser/extensions/extension_input_api.cc',
919 'browser/extensions/extension_input_api.h', 919 'browser/extensions/extension_input_api.h',
920 'browser/extensions/extension_input_ui_api.cc',
921 'browser/extensions/extension_input_ui_api.h',
920 'browser/extensions/extension_install_dialog.h', 922 'browser/extensions/extension_install_dialog.h',
921 'browser/extensions/extension_install_ui.cc', 923 'browser/extensions/extension_install_ui.cc',
922 'browser/extensions/extension_install_ui.h', 924 'browser/extensions/extension_install_ui.h',
923 'browser/extensions/extension_management_api.cc', 925 'browser/extensions/extension_management_api.cc',
924 'browser/extensions/extension_management_api.h', 926 'browser/extensions/extension_management_api.h',
925 'browser/extensions/extension_menu_manager.cc', 927 'browser/extensions/extension_menu_manager.cc',
926 'browser/extensions/extension_menu_manager.h', 928 'browser/extensions/extension_menu_manager.h',
927 'browser/extensions/extension_message_handler.cc', 929 'browser/extensions/extension_message_handler.cc',
928 'browser/extensions/extension_message_handler.h', 930 'browser/extensions/extension_message_handler.h',
929 'browser/extensions/extension_message_service.cc', 931 'browser/extensions/extension_message_service.cc',
(...skipping 2550 matching lines...) Expand 10 before | Expand all | Expand 10 after
3480 ], 3482 ],
3481 }], 3483 }],
3482 ['debug_devtools==1', { 3484 ['debug_devtools==1', {
3483 'defines': [ 3485 'defines': [
3484 'DEBUG_DEVTOOLS=1', 3486 'DEBUG_DEVTOOLS=1',
3485 ], 3487 ],
3486 }], 3488 }],
3487 ['chromeos==0', { 3489 ['chromeos==0', {
3488 'sources/': [ 3490 'sources/': [
3489 ['exclude', '^browser/chromeos'], 3491 ['exclude', '^browser/chromeos'],
3492 ['exclude', '^browser/extensions/extension_input_ui_api.cc'],
3493 ['exclude', '^browser/extensions/extension_input_ui_api.h'],
3490 ['exclude', '^browser/ui/webui/chromeos'], 3494 ['exclude', '^browser/ui/webui/chromeos'],
3491 ['exclude', '^browser/ui/webui/options/chromeos'], 3495 ['exclude', '^browser/ui/webui/options/chromeos'],
3492 ['exclude', 'browser/extensions/extension_file_browser_private_api.c c'], 3496 ['exclude', 'browser/extensions/extension_file_browser_private_api.c c'],
3493 ['exclude', 'browser/extensions/extension_file_browser_private_api.h '], 3497 ['exclude', 'browser/extensions/extension_file_browser_private_api.h '],
3494 ['exclude', 'browser/extensions/extension_tts_api_chromeos.cc'], 3498 ['exclude', 'browser/extensions/extension_tts_api_chromeos.cc'],
3495 ['exclude', 'browser/extensions/file_manager_util.h'], 3499 ['exclude', 'browser/extensions/file_manager_util.h'],
3496 ['exclude', 'browser/extensions/file_manager_util.cc'], 3500 ['exclude', 'browser/extensions/file_manager_util.cc'],
3497 ['exclude', 'browser/oom_priority_manager.cc'], 3501 ['exclude', 'browser/oom_priority_manager.cc'],
3498 ['exclude', 'browser/oom_priority_manager.h'], 3502 ['exclude', 'browser/oom_priority_manager.h'],
3499 ['exclude', 'browser/policy/device_policy_cache.cc'], 3503 ['exclude', 'browser/policy/device_policy_cache.cc'],
(...skipping 43 matching lines...) Expand 10 before | Expand all | Expand 10 after
3543 ['use_gnome_keyring==0', { 3547 ['use_gnome_keyring==0', {
3544 'sources!': [ 3548 'sources!': [
3545 'browser/password_manager/native_backend_gnome_x.cc', 3549 'browser/password_manager/native_backend_gnome_x.cc',
3546 'browser/password_manager/native_backend_gnome_x.h', 3550 'browser/password_manager/native_backend_gnome_x.h',
3547 ], 3551 ],
3548 }], 3552 }],
3549 ['touchui==0', { 3553 ['touchui==0', {
3550 'sources/': [ 3554 'sources/': [
3551 ['exclude', '^browser/chromeos/frame/dom_*'], 3555 ['exclude', '^browser/chromeos/frame/dom_*'],
3552 ['exclude', '^browser/chromeos/login/dom_*'], 3556 ['exclude', '^browser/chromeos/login/dom_*'],
3557 ['exclude', '^browser/extensions/extension_input_ui_api.cc'],
3558 ['exclude', '^browser/extensions/extension_input_ui_api.h'],
3553 ['exclude', '^browser/webui/keyboard_ui.*'], 3559 ['exclude', '^browser/webui/keyboard_ui.*'],
3554 ['exclude', '^browser/renderer_host/render_widget_host_view_views.*' ], 3560 ['exclude', '^browser/renderer_host/render_widget_host_view_views.*' ],
3555 ['exclude', '^browser/ui/touch/*'], 3561 ['exclude', '^browser/ui/touch/*'],
3556 ['exclude', '^browser/ui/views/tab_contents/tab_contents_container_v iews.cc'], 3562 ['exclude', '^browser/ui/views/tab_contents/tab_contents_container_v iews.cc'],
3557 ['exclude', '^browser/ui/views/tab_contents/tab_contents_container_v iews.h'], 3563 ['exclude', '^browser/ui/views/tab_contents/tab_contents_container_v iews.h'],
3558 ['exclude', '^browser/ui/views/tab_contents/tab_contents_view_touch. *'], 3564 ['exclude', '^browser/ui/views/tab_contents/tab_contents_view_touch. *'],
3559 ['exclude', '^browser/ui/webui/chromeos/login/'], 3565 ['exclude', '^browser/ui/webui/chromeos/login/'],
3560 ], 3566 ],
3561 }], 3567 }],
3562 ['touchui==1', { 3568 ['touchui==1', {
(...skipping 671 matching lines...) Expand 10 before | Expand all | Expand 10 after
4234 ['include', '^browser/ui/views/frame/browser_non_client_frame_vi ew_factory_gtk.cc'], 4240 ['include', '^browser/ui/views/frame/browser_non_client_frame_vi ew_factory_gtk.cc'],
4235 ['include', '^browser/ui/views/notifications/balloon_view.cc'], 4241 ['include', '^browser/ui/views/notifications/balloon_view.cc'],
4236 ['include', '^browser/ui/views/notifications/balloon_view.h'], 4242 ['include', '^browser/ui/views/notifications/balloon_view.h'],
4237 ['exclude', '^browser/ui/views/keyboard_overlay_delegate.cc'], 4243 ['exclude', '^browser/ui/views/keyboard_overlay_delegate.cc'],
4238 ['exclude', '^browser/ui/views/keyboard_overlay_delegate.h'], 4244 ['exclude', '^browser/ui/views/keyboard_overlay_delegate.h'],
4239 ['exclude', '^browser/ui/views/keyboard_overlay_dialog_view.cc'] , 4245 ['exclude', '^browser/ui/views/keyboard_overlay_dialog_view.cc'] ,
4240 ['exclude', '^browser/ui/views/keyboard_overlay_dialog_view.h'], 4246 ['exclude', '^browser/ui/views/keyboard_overlay_dialog_view.h'],
4241 ['exclude', '^browser/ui/views/select_file_dialog.cc'], 4247 ['exclude', '^browser/ui/views/select_file_dialog.cc'],
4242 ], 4248 ],
4243 }], 4249 }],
4250 # Exclude extension_input_ui_api again
4251 # (Required because of the '^browser/extensions/' include abrove)
4252 ['OS=="linux" and ( touchui==0 or chromeos==0 )', {
4253 'sources/': [
4254 ['exclude', '^browser/extensions/extension_input_ui_api.cc'],
4255 ['exclude', '^browser/extensions/extension_input_ui_api.h'],
4256 ],
4257 }],
4244 # GTK build only 4258 # GTK build only
4245 ['OS=="linux" and toolkit_views==0', { 4259 ['OS=="linux" and toolkit_views==0', {
4246 'sources/': [ 4260 'sources/': [
4247 ['include', '^browser/printing/print_dialog_gtk.cc'], 4261 ['include', '^browser/printing/print_dialog_gtk.cc'],
4248 ['include', '^browser/printing/print_dialog_gtk.h'], 4262 ['include', '^browser/printing/print_dialog_gtk.h'],
4249 ['exclude', '^browser/bookmarks/bookmark_drop_info.cc'], 4263 ['exclude', '^browser/bookmarks/bookmark_drop_info.cc'],
4250 ['exclude', '^browser/ui/browser_list_stub.cc'], 4264 ['exclude', '^browser/ui/browser_list_stub.cc'],
4251 ['exclude', '^browser/ui/views/autocomplete/autocomplete_popup_g tk.cc'], 4265 ['exclude', '^browser/ui/views/autocomplete/autocomplete_popup_g tk.cc'],
4252 ['exclude', '^browser/ui/views/autocomplete/autocomplete_popup_g tk.h'], 4266 ['exclude', '^browser/ui/views/autocomplete/autocomplete_popup_g tk.h'],
4253 ['exclude', '^browser/ui/panels/panel_browser_frame_view.cc'], 4267 ['exclude', '^browser/ui/panels/panel_browser_frame_view.cc'],
(...skipping 287 matching lines...) Expand 10 before | Expand all | Expand 10 after
4541 'hard_dependency': 1, 4555 'hard_dependency': 1,
4542 }, 4556 },
4543 ], 4557 ],
4544 } 4558 }
4545 4559
4546 # Local Variables: 4560 # Local Variables:
4547 # tab-width:2 4561 # tab-width:2
4548 # indent-tabs-mode:nil 4562 # indent-tabs-mode:nil
4549 # End: 4563 # End:
4550 # vim: set expandtab tabstop=2 shiftwidth=2: 4564 # vim: set expandtab tabstop=2 shiftwidth=2:
OLDNEW
« no previous file with comments | « chrome/browser/extensions/extension_service.cc ('k') | chrome/common/extensions/api/extension_api.json » ('j') | no next file with comments »

Powered by Google App Engine
This is Rietveld 408576698